10139N/A#
10139N/A# spec file for packages SUNWgnome-media
10139N/A#
16880N/A# includes module(s): libgnome-media-profiles
10139N/A#
10139N/A# Copyright 2009 Sun Microsystems, Inc.
10139N/A# This file and all modifications and additions to the pristine
10139N/A# package are under the same license as the package itself.
10139N/A#
16880N/A%define owner yippi
17178N/A#
17178N/A%include Solaris.inc
10139N/A
16880N/A%use gmedia = libgnome-media-profiles.spec
10139N/A
17089N/AName: SUNWlibgnome-media
12578N/AIPS_package_name: gnome/media/gnome-media
10139N/AMeta(info.classification): %{classification_prefix}:Applications/Sound and Video
10139N/ASummary: GNOME media components
10139N/AVersion: %{gmedia.version}
16880N/ASource: %{name}-manpages-0.1.tar.gz
16880N/ASUNW_BaseDir: %{_basedir}
16880N/ASUNW_Copyright: %{name}.copyright
16880N/ALicense: %{gmedia.license}
16880N/ABuildRoot: %{_tmppath}/%{name}-%{version}-build
17089N/A
17089N/A%include default-depend.inc
16880N/A%include gnome-incorporation.inc
16880N/ABuildRequires: SUNWbison
16880N/ABuildRequires: SUNWglib2-devel
16880N/ABuildRequires: SUNWgtk3-devel
16880N/ABuildRequires: SUNWgnome-config-devel
16880N/ABuildRequires: SUNWgnome-media-devel
16880N/ABuildRequires: SUNWgnome-doc-utils
16880N/ARequires: SUNWglib2
16880N/ARequires: SUNWgtk3
16880N/ARequires: SUNWlibglade
16880N/ARequires: SUNWlibms
17089N/ARequires: SUNWdesktop-cache
17073N/ARequires: SUNWgnome-config
17089N/ARequires: SUNWgnome-media
17074N/ARequires: SUNWlibgnome-media-root
17089N/ARequires: SUNWgnome-ui-designer
16880N/A
10139N/A%package root
10139N/ASummary: %{summary} - / filesystem
10139N/ASUNW_BaseDir: /
10139N/A%include default-depend.inc
12274N/A%include gnome-incorporation.inc
12274N/A
12274N/A%package l10n
12274N/ASummary: %{summary} - l10n files
10139N/ARequires: %{name}
10139N/A
10139N/A%package devel
10139N/ASummary: %{summary} - development files
11002N/ASUNW_BaseDir: %{_basedir}
13025N/A%include default-depend.inc
12830N/A%include gnome-incorporation.inc
13664N/A
16425N/A%prep
15591N/Arm -rf %name-%version
17073N/Amkdir %name-%version
10139N/A%gmedia.prep -d %name-%version
10139N/Acd %{_builddir}/%name-%version
10139N/Agzcat %SOURCE0 | tar xf -
10139N/A
10139N/A%build
10139N/A# Note that including __STDC_VERSION n CFLAGS for gnome-media breaks the S9
10139N/A# build for gstreamer, gst-plugins, and gnome-media, so not including for them.
10139N/A#
10139N/Aexport CFLAGS="%optflags -I/usr/sfw/include -DANSICPP"
10139N/Aexport RPM_OPT_FLAGS="$CFLAGS"
10139N/Aexport ACLOCAL_FLAGS="-I %{_datadir}/aclocal"
10139N/Aexport LDFLAGS="%_ldflags"
10139N/A
16880N/A%gmedia.build -d %name-%version
16880N/A
16880N/A%install
16880N/Arm -rf $RPM_BUILD_ROOT
16880N/A%gmedia.install -d %name-%version
16880N/A
10139N/Arm -rf $RPM_BUILD_ROOT%{_mandir}
16880N/Acd %{_builddir}/%name-%version/sun-manpages
16880N/Amake install DESTDIR=$RPM_BUILD_ROOT
10139N/A
10139N/Achmod 755 $RPM_BUILD_ROOT%{_mandir}/man1/*.1
10139N/A
16880N/A# Remove .la and .a file as we do not ship them.
16880N/Afind $RPM_BUILD_ROOT -name "*.la" -exec rm {} \;
10139N/Afind $RPM_BUILD_ROOT -name "*.a" -exec rm {} \;
10139N/A
16880N/A%{?pkgbuild_postprocess: %pkgbuild_postprocess -v -c "%{version}:%{jds_version}:%{name}:$RPM_ARCH:%(date +%%Y-%%m-%%d):%{support_level}" $RPM_BUILD_ROOT}
11155N/A
16880N/A%clean
16880N/Arm -rf $RPM_BUILD_ROOT
16880N/A
10139N/A%post
10139N/A%restart_fmri desktop-mime-cache icon-cache gconf-cache
10139N/A
10139N/A%postun
16880N/A%restart_fmri desktop-mime-cache
16880N/A
16880N/A%files
16880N/A%defattr (-, root, bin)
10139N/A%dir %attr (0755, root, bin) %{_bindir}
17059N/A%{_bindir}/gnome-audio-profiles-properties
17059N/A%dir %attr (0755, root, bin) %{_libdir}
17059N/A%{_libdir}/libgnome-media*.so*
16880N/A#%{_libdir}/libglade/2.0/lib*.so*
16880N/A%dir %attr (0755, root, sys) %{_datadir}
16880N/A%doc libgnome-media-profiles-%{gmedia.version}/README
17059N/A%doc(bzip2) libgnome-media-profiles-%{gmedia.version}/COPYING
17059N/A%doc(bzip2) libgnome-media-profiles-%{gmedia.version}/NEWS
11358N/A%dir %attr (0755, root, other) %{_datadir}/doc
16880N/A%dir %attr (0755, root, other) %{_datadir}/gnome
16880N/A%{_datadir}/libgnome-media-profiles
10248N/A%{_datadir}/omf/gnome-audio-profiles/gnome-audio-profiles-C.omf
16880N/A%{_datadir}/gnome/help/gnome-audio-profiles/C/legal.xml
16880N/A%{_datadir}/gnome/help/gnome-audio-profiles/C/figures/gnome-audio-profiles-profiles-window.png
10139N/A%{_datadir}/gnome/help/gnome-audio-profiles/C/figures/gnome-audio-profiles-profile-window.png
10139N/A%{_datadir}/gnome/help/gnome-audio-profiles/C/gnome-audio-profiles.xml
10139N/A%dir %attr(0755, root, bin) %{_mandir}
10139N/A%dir %attr(0755, root, bin) %{_mandir}/man1
10139N/A%dir %attr(0755, root, bin) %{_mandir}/man3
16880N/A%{_mandir}/man1/gnome-audio-profiles-properties.1
16880N/A%{_mandir}/man3/*
16880N/A
16880N/A%files l10n
16880N/A%defattr (-, root, bin)
16880N/A%dir %attr (0755, root, sys) %{_datadir}
16880N/A%dir %attr (0755, root, other) %{_datadir}/gnome
16880N/A%attr (-, root, other) %{_datadir}/locale
16880N/A%{_datadir}/gnome/help/*/[a-z]*
16880N/A%{_datadir}/omf/*/*-[a-z][a-z].omf
16880N/A%{_datadir}/omf/*/*-[a-z][a-z]_[A-Z][A-Z].omf
16880N/A
16880N/A%files root
16880N/A%defattr (-, root, sys)
16880N/A%attr (0755, root, sys) %dir %{_sysconfdir}
16880N/A%{_sysconfdir}/gconf/schemas/gnome-media-profiles.schemas
16880N/A
16880N/A%files devel
16880N/A%defattr (-, root, bin)
16880N/A%dir %attr (0755, root, bin) %{_libdir}
16880N/A%dir %attr (0755, root, other) %{_libdir}/pkgconfig
16880N/A%{_libdir}/pkgconfig/*
16880N/A%dir %attr (0755, root, bin) %{_includedir}
16880N/A%{_includedir}/libgnome-media-profiles-3.0
16880N/A%dir %attr (0755, root, sys) %{_datadir}
16880N/A
16880N/A%changelog
16880N/A* Tue Jun 08 2010 - Michal.Pryc@Oracle.Com
16880N/A- Updated BuildRequires to fit SourceJuicer.
16880N/A* Sun Mar 21 2010 - christian.kelly@sun.com
16880N/A- Add Requires SUNWgnome-ui-designer.
10139N/A* Tue Jan 05 2010 - dave.lin@sun.com
16880N/A- Changed the dependency from CBEbison to SUNWbison.
16880N/A* Thu Jul 30 2009 - brian.cameron@sun.com
16880N/A- Fix up packaging after bumping to 2.27.5.
16880N/A* Fri Jul 24 2009 - christian.kelly@sun.com
10139N/A- Fix up pkg'ing.
10139N/A* Fri Apr 17 2009 - brian.cameron@sun.com
17089N/A- Add SUNWlibcanberra as a dependency. It is needed for the "Sound Theme" tab
17089N/A to be built into gnome-volume-control.
17073N/A* Fri Apr 3 2009 - laca@sun.com
17073N/A- use desktop-cache instead of postrun
17059N/A* ???
17059N/A- Uncomment the line "%{_datadir}/omf/*/*-[a-z][a-z]_[A-Z][A-Z].omf"
17059N/A in %file l10n as the file is available in 2.26.0.
16880N/A* Fri Sep 26 2008 - brian.cameron@sun.com
16880N/A- Now that the GPLv3 mixup is fixed, add new copyright files.
16880N/A* Tue Jun 03 2008 - brian.cameron@sun.com
16623N/A- Packaging changes related to bumping to 2.23. No longer ship
16623N/A cddb code or vumeter since these are no longer supported upstream.
16511N/A Remove support for building with gnome-cd since this is also
16511N/A no longer supported upstream. Removes SUNWgnome-freedb-libs/-root.
16395N/A* Wed May 07 2008 - damien.carbery@sun.com
16395N/A- Remove PERL5LIB setting as it is not necessary.
16193N/A* Wed Apr 02 2008 - brian.cameron@sun.com
16193N/A- Add SUNW_Copyright.
16190N/A* Wed Mar 12 2008 - damien.carbery@sun.com
16190N/A- Update %files for new tarball.
16054N/A* Thu Jan 3 2008 - laca@sun.com
16054N/A- use gconf-install.script instead of an inline script
16013N/A* Mon Oct 8 2007 - damien.carbery@sun.com
16013N/A- Remove some icons from base package because they are already in
16013N/A SUNWgnome-sound-recorder. Fixes 6613798.
16038N/A* Wed Sep 19 2007 - damien.carbery@sun.com
15968N/A- Update %files for 2.20.0 tarball - remove omf files and move png files.
15968N/A* Wed Sep 05 2007 - damien.carbery@sun.com
15968N/A- Remove references to SUNWgnome-a11y-base-libs as its contents have been
15792N/A moved to SUNWgnome-base-libs.
15792N/A* Wed Jan 24 2007 - brian.cameron@sun.com
15591N/A- Change %with_cd to %build_with_gnome_cd with suggestions from Laca.
15591N/A* Tue Jan 23 2007 - brian.cameron@sun.com
15591N/A- Add %with_cd logic so it is easier to build with gnome-cd if desired.
15543N/A* Mon Oct 16 2006 - damien.carbery@sun.com
15543N/A- Remove the '-rf' from the 'rm *.la *.a' lines so that any changes to the
15543N/A module source will be seen as a build error and action can be taken.
15543N/A* Mon Sep 04 2006 - Matt.Keenan@sun.com
15503N/A- New Manpage tarball
15503N/A* Mon Aug 21 2006 - damien.carbery@sun.com
15460N/A- Fix l10n package - C locale omf file was in base and l10n package.
15460N/A* Fri Jul 14 2006 - laca@sun.com
15389N/A- update %post/%postun/etc scripts to support diskless client setup,
15389N/A part of 6448317
15389N/A* Thu Jun 29 2006 - laca@sun.com
15347N/A- update postrun scripts
15347N/A* Sun Jun 11 2006 - laca@sun.com
15347N/A- change group from other to bin/sys
15347N/A* Fri Jun 2 2006 - laca@sun.com
15247N/A- use post/preun scripts to install schemas into the merged gconf files
15247N/A* Thu May 04 2006 - laca@sun.com
15230N/A- merge -share pkg(s) into the base pkg(s)
15230N/A* Tue Mar 28 2006 - brian.cameron@sun.com
14468N/A- Removed SUNWgnome-cd, since now using sound-juicer.
14468N/A* Tue Feb 21 2006 - damien.carbery@sun.com
14362N/A- Just a few more dependencies for SUNWgnome-cd.
14362N/A* Mon Feb 20 2006 - damien.carbery@sun.com
14133N/A- Complete update of Build/Requires after running check-deps.pl script.
14133N/A* Fri Feb 17 2006 - damien.carbery@sun.com
14126N/A- Update Build/Requires after running check-deps.pl script.
14126N/A* Fri Jan 20 2006 - brian.cameron@sun.com
14014N/A- Do not package gstreamer gconf files since GStreamer already installs
14014N/A its own.
14014N/A* Sat Dec 3 2005 - laca@sun.com
14014N/A- add %post script that runs update-desktop-database
14014N/A* Tue Nov 29 2005 - laca@sun.com
14014N/A- remove javahelp stuff
14014N/A* Fri Sep 30 2005 - brian.cameron@sun.com
14014N/A- Fix l10n packaging.
13907N/A* Thu Sep 22 2005 - brian.cameron@sun.com
13907N/A- Build gnome-cd again since sound-juicer doesn't build on Solaris.
13819N/A* Wed Sep 21 2005 - brian.cameron@sun.com
13819N/A- Fix packaging.
13786N/A* Tue Jul 12 2005 - balamurali.viswanathan@wipro.com
13786N/A- Don't build gnome-cd and remove nautilus-cd-burner dependency
13786N/A* Tue Jul 12 2005 - balamurali.viswanathan@wipro.com
13786N/A- Add nautilus-cd-burner dependency
13786N/A* Thu Jul 07 2005 - balamurali.viswanathan@wipro.com
13491N/A- Initial spec-file created
13453N/A
13453N/A
13453N/A
13317N/A